In the 77095 zip code of Houston, TX, crime rates are significantly higher than the national averages. The violent crime rate in this area is 40.7, compared to the US average of 22.7. This means that residents of this area are at a higher risk of experiencing violent crimes such as assault, robbery, and homicide. The property crime rate in 77095 is also above the national average at 51.1, compared to 35.4. This includes crimes such as burglary, theft, and motor vehicle theft. The prevalence of crime in this area can be attributed to various socioeconomic factors, such as poverty and population density. It is important for residents of 77095 to be vigilant and take necessary precautions to protect themselves and their property in this high-crime area.

Crime is ranked on a scale of 1 (low crime) to 100 (high crime)

Houston (zip 77095) violent crime is 40.7. (The US average is 22.7)
Houston (zip 77095) property crime is 51.1. (The US average is 35.4)
